When it comes to recording sales that you haven’t received payments for, you have to understand what accrualaccounting is. The word “accrual” means that an entry is made in your books each time a revenue has been made or an expense has been incurred but without the actual money transfer.

Managing Accounts Receivable Manually If your accountingsystem is on a cash basis, AR isn’t an issue. If you use accrualaccounting, you record transactions as soon as you earn the money. This requires crunching more numbers than cash accounting, but it gives you a better perspective on your income.
